Why a Humidifier for Indoor Plants Is Necessary

I’ve found that a humidifier makes a big difference for indoor plants, especially when the air in my home gets dry from heating or air conditioning. Many houseplants naturally come from humid environments, so when the air is too dry, their leaves can start to curl, brown at the edges, or lose their healthy look. By adding moisture to the air, I help my plants stay closer to the conditions they’re used to in nature.

I also notice that a humidifier helps my plants grow better and stay less stressed. Dry air can make it harder for them to absorb moisture properly, even when I water them regularly. With more balanced humidity, my plants seem to keep their leaves fuller, their growth steadier, and their overall appearance healthier.

For me, using a humidifier is a simple way to support my indoor plants without overwatering them. It creates a more comfortable environment for tropical plants like ferns, calatheas, and orchids, which really benefit from extra humidity. In my experience, it’s one of the easiest tools for keeping indoor plants happier year-round.

My Buying Guides on Humidifier For Indoor Plants

Why I Use a Humidifier for Indoor Plants

I’ve found that many indoor plants struggle when the air gets too dry, especially during winter or in air-conditioned rooms. A humidifier helps me maintain the moisture levels my plants need, which can reduce browning leaf edges, wilting, and stress. For plants like calatheas, ferns, orchids, and monsteras, I’ve noticed a big difference when I keep the humidity more consistent.

What I Look for Before Buying

When I shop for a humidifier for my plants, I focus on a few important things. I want something that fits the size of my room, runs quietly, and is easy to clean. I also pay attention to how much mist it produces, because too little won’t help, and too much can make the area damp.

Room Size and Coverage

The first thing I consider is the size of the space where my plants are placed. If I’m using it for a small shelf or plant corner, a compact humidifier usually works well. For a larger room with many plants, I choose a model with higher output so the humidity reaches all my plants evenly.

Mist Output and Humidity Control

I prefer a humidifier with adjustable mist settings because different plants need different moisture levels. Some days I need a gentle mist, while other times I need stronger output. If possible, I look for one with a built-in humidity sensor or auto shut-off so I can avoid over-humidifying the room.

Quiet Operation

Since my plants are often in my bedroom or living space, I like a humidifier that runs quietly. A noisy machine can be distracting, especially if I use it overnight. I usually check s to make sure the sound level is low enough for daily use.

Easy Cleaning and Maintenance

I’ve learned that a humidifier is only helpful if I keep it clean. I look for models with wide tank openings and simple parts that are easy to wash. This helps me prevent mold, mineral buildup, and bacteria from spreading around my plants and home.

Tank Capacity and Run Time

I also check the tank size before buying. A larger tank means I don’t have to refill it as often, which is convenient if I use it every day. For me, a longer run time is especially useful when I want steady humidity through the night or while I’m away for a few hours.

Warm Mist vs. Cool Mist

Most of the time, I choose a cool mist humidifier for my indoor plants because it is safer and works well in most conditions. Warm mist models can be useful in some cases, but I usually prefer cool mist since it feels more practical for plant care and everyday use.

Placement Matters

I always think about where I’ll place the humidifier. I keep it close enough to benefit the plants, but not so close that water droplets sit directly on the leaves. I’ve found that placing it a few feet away and letting the mist spread naturally works best.

Extra Features I Appreciate

Some features make a humidifier even more useful for me. I like automatic shut-off, timer settings, and top-fill designs because they save time and make daily use easier. If the humidifier also has a night light or aroma function, I only consider it if those features don’t interfere with plant care.
